Expenses that both gas and electric cars have are tires, brakes, and windshield wipes. However, vehicle maintenance costs can rack up over the lifespan of a car, especially with ICEs (internal combustion engines), engine maintenance can be very expensive, even more so with an older car. Add in changing oil, engine coolant, and other miscellaneous fluids the money can add up very quickly over time. As for electric vehicles, they don’t have these expenses. Although, they are not without expenses. For example, a new battery could cost a significant amount of money to replace, but with these cars mostly being very new and under warranty this would not be an issue the owner would have to worry about paying for. Many people are debating whether they should invest in an electric car or not. The pros with electric cars is that it is much better for the environment than gasoline powered cars. The gasoline cars release toxic subjects into the air which is harmful for both the environment and us humans. Another pro with driving an electric car is that individuals will save lot of money since they do not have to pay for gas anymore. For example, for someone who drives twelve thousand miles per year, the driver would have to pay around $1,603 for gas. Meanwhile, a driver who drives an electric car for the same number of miles, only have to pay $449 for the electricity. Individuals would save $1,154 every year and at the same time do the environment a favor.

Electric vehicles are a fairly new thing, so charging station are not always available and plugging in at home can take hours compared to the one half hour it takes at a charging station. Electric vehicles also have great benefits. Electric vehicles convert more than double of their power to the wheels compared to a gasoline engine (“What Are Electric Cars”). Electric vehicles feel fast because the power is delivered instantly to the wheels. Another benefit of an electric vehicle is they are virtually silent (Wilson). Electric vehicles are good for city use, were the daily commute is short and access to power is readily available.
